    • An object of the present invention is to provide a catalyst for a lower alcohol oxidation reaction which makes possible to manufacture a partial oxide of a lower alcohol such as dimethoxymethane or the like selectively and efficiently by direct oxidation of a lower alcohol such as methanol or the like, and to provide a method for manufacturing a partial oxide of a lower alcohol such as dimethoxymethane or the like selectively and efficiently from a lower alcohol such as methanol or the like by using this catalyst for a lower alcohol oxidation reaction. A partial oxide of a lower alcohol such as dimethoxymethane or the like is manufactured by subjecting a lower alcohol to vapor phase contact oxidation with a molecular oxygen-containing gas in the presence of an oxidation reaction catalyst for a lower alcohol composed of a rhenium-antimony compound oxide such as SbRe2O6 or the like. When the vapor phase contact oxidation is conducted, in particular, at a temperature of 300 to 400° C., dimethoxymethane can be manufactured highly selectively.
    • 本发明的目的是提供一种用于低级醇氧化反应的催化剂,其可以通过直接氧化低级醇如甲醇或其它醇来选择性和有效地制备低级醇如二甲氧基甲烷等的部分氧化物 并且提供通过使用该低级醇氧化反应用催化剂从低级醇如甲醇等中选择性且有效地制备低级醇如二甲氧基甲烷等的部分氧化物的方法。 在由铼 - 锑组成的低级醇的氧化反应催化剂的存在下,通过使含低分子量的气体进行气相接触氧化来制造低级醇如二甲氧基甲烷等的部分氧化物 复合氧化物如SbRe 2 O 6等。 进行气相接触氧化时,特别是在300〜400℃的温度下,能够高选择性地制造二甲氧基甲烷。
